Description

Water pond formula photo-induction mosquito catcher
Technical field
This utility model is related to Mosquito catching device, and in particular to a kind of water pond formula photo-induction mosquito catcher.
Background technology
During the broiling summer, people's anti-mosquito incense sheet or during mosquito-driving liquid anophelifuge, allowing some body constitution differences or has allergic constitution People thinks there are the anaphylaxiss such as giddy, headache, and mosquito incense also has harm to infant body;Without mosquito incense, mosquito and four Place wreaks havoc, bite people is difficult to fall asleep, therefore invent a kind of novel mosquito catcher and be very important.
At present existing mosquito catcher, using mosquito-driving liquid or anti-mosquito incense sheet etc., there is pollution to environment, and use cost is of a relatively high.
Chinese patent discloses a kind of mosquito killing lamp of the U of Publication No. CN 205547068, and the mosquito killing lamp includes:One top Open region, an electric supply installation, a control circuit, more than one lighting unit, a titanium dioxide part, a fan, a storage tank And a drainage;Wherein, the electric supply installation, the lighting unit and fan difference electrical ties control circuit;Open on the top The titanium dioxide part is provided with mouth region, and more than one lighting unit and drainage are provided with around the titanium dioxide part;This two Titanium oxide part lower section is provided with the fan, and it is the device of a downward convulsion, and connects the storage tank in the fan lower section;And the row Water channel is from top to bottom engaged in the mosquito killing lamp.Although the mosquito killing lamp realizes to a certain extent the function of mosquito eradication, this catches mosquito Lamp exist shortcoming be:By the way that mosquito is introduced in storage tank, and then the mosquito being introduced into kills, the processing method trouble, and One has mosquito to enter is accomplished by closing storage tank, and the energy of consuming is more, is unfavorable for energy-conservation;By producing carbon dioxide and light-emitting junction Close, with attracting mosquitoes, but the attractant effect is bad.

Specific embodiment
Embodiment 1:
As shown in figure 1, a kind of water pond formula photo-induction mosquito catcher, including:
Accommodating chamber 111 is provided with housing 11, housing 11;
Attractant unit 12, it includes luminescence unit 121, and luminescence unit 121 is arranged in accommodating chamber 111, to lure mosquito Son flies to housing 11;And
Unit 13 is catched and killed, it includes holding disk 131, hold disk 131 and be arranged on the top board of housing 11, held in disk 131 It is provided with mosquito killing liquid 132;
Wherein, the top board of the base plate and housing 11 that hold disk 131 is made using transparent material, so that light-transmissive.
For simple, the easy to use luminescence unit 121 of design structure, it is preferred that luminescence unit 121 includes:
LED light source 122, in accommodating chamber 111 installing rack 125 is provided with, and LED light source 122 is installed on installing rack 125;
LED driver 123, it is arranged in housing 11 and its outfan is electrically connected with LED light source 122;And
Plug 124, it is arranged at, and housing 11 is outer and it is electrically connected with the input of LED driver 123, to connect extraneous electricity Source.Plug 124 connects after extraneous power supply, and LED driver 123 drives LED light source 122 to switch on power, and then sends light.
Embodiment 2:
The present embodiment is with the difference of embodiment 1:In order to prevent because it is counter have high light to send affect user to sleep, The mounting means of LED light source has done further improvement.
As shown in Fig. 2 specifically, installing rack 22 is cell structure, and LED light source 21 be installed on installing rack 22 away from Sheng On the face of sale at reduced prices 131, the side for holding disk 131 is provided with reflector 23 in installing rack 22, so that LED light source 21 sends Light reflection, the reflecting surface of reflector 23 is arcuate structure.The light that LED light source 21 sends, after the reflection of reflector 23, penetrates To holding disk 131, and then directive is extraneous, because the reflecting surface of reflector 23 is arcuate structure so that the light after reflection to Four directions scattering, prevents people from dazzling phenomenon is produced when holding disk 131 soon, while use in the evening, high light is there will not be, beneficial to sleeping Sleep.
In order to further prevent the center of reflector 23 from still having high light to send, it is preferred that reflector 23 is towards LED light source 21 Face be provided centrally with beam-splitter 24.Because although reflector 23 is arc, the center of reflector 23 is similar to plane, Therefore dispersion effect is bad, by arranging beam-splitter, can further prevent the formation of direct light, and then further prevents reflective The center of plate 23 still has high light to send.
Embodiment 3:
The present embodiment is with the difference of embodiment 1 and embodiment 2:Imitate to further improve the attraction to mosquito Really, the predating efficiency to mosquito and is further improved, to attractant unit and unit is catched and killed and has been done further design.
As shown in figure 3, specifically, attractant unit also includes:Attractant unit 31, the internal memory of attractant unit 31 is placed with people Work perspiration, is provided with housing 32 and lures chamber 322 below accommodating chamber 321, is provided with and draws on the side wall of housing 32 The sending-out hole 323 for luring chamber 322 to connect, to give out synthetic perspiration by luring chamber 322;
Catching and killing unit also includes:Patch 34 is catched and killed, release paper 35 is provided with the sidewall surfaces of housing 32, pasted on release paper 35 Patch 34 is catched and killed, to be catched and killed and be provided with the viscose that can cling mosquito on 34 outermost layers of patch;
Wherein, the through hole 351 being aligned with sending-out hole 323, the diameter of through hole 351 and sending-out hole 323 are provided with release paper 35 Equal diameters, to catch and kill and be evenly arranged with several pores 341 in patch 34, and pore 341 can not be passed through for mosquito, and have pore 341 Connect with sending-out hole 323.By the setting of attractant unit, further increase the attraction factor to mosquito, so as to improve to mosquito The attraction effect of son.Synthetic perspiration in attractant unit is distributed by luring chamber 322, and then passes sequentially through sending-out hole 323rd, through hole 351, pore 341, are eventually leading to the external world, after mosquito is attracted, fly to housing 32, and then are catched and killed the adhesion of patch 34 Firmly, mosquito is killed, and effect is good, the principle of catching and killing for catching and killing patch 34 is similar to (fly patch).Release paper 35 is disposed to just Catch and kill patch 34 in replacing so that catch and kill patch and 34 be easy to tear, and will not contaminated air, it is easy to use.
For simple, the easy to use attractant unit of design structure, it is preferred that attractant unit 31 includes:
Tray 311, it is arranged at lures in chamber 322, to deposit synthetic perspiration;
Drain funnel 312, it is installed on the outer surface of housing 32 and its position is higher than the top surface of tray 311;And
Connecting tube 313, it connects drain funnel 312 with tray 311.By arranging tray 311, disk is continued to use It is open so that synthetic perspiration can shed automatically, simple structure and easy to use.And when needing to add synthetic perspiration, it is only necessary to Take the synthetic perspiration for preparing to add in drain funnel 312, using siphonage, synthetic perspiration is automatically by connecting tube 313 enter in tray 311, and so as to realize the addition of synthetic perspiration, and Adding Way is simple.
In order that the synthetic perspiration for giving out carries certain temperature, it is more nearly human body and distributes perspiration, with further Improve the attraction effect to mosquito, it is preferred that attractant unit 31 also includes:
Heater 314, it is placed in the lower section of tray 311, and tray 311 is made using Heat Conduction Material, with by storage The heated intraocular's perspiration of disk 311;
Temperature sensor 315, it is arranged in tray 311, to detect temperature in tray 311;
Liquid level sensor 316, it is arranged in tray 311, to detect the liquid level of synthetic perspiration in tray 311;
Controller (not shown), heater 314, temperature sensor 315 and liquid level sensor 316 connect with controller Connect, to control the running of heater 314 according to the detection data of temperature sensor 315 and liquid level sensor 316;And
Warning light (not shown), it is connected with controller, to send bright prompting when the liquid level of synthetic perspiration is too low. The temperature of synthetic perspiration in the real-time monitoring tray 311 of temperature sensor 315, and then the running of heater 314 is controlled, realizing will The temperature control of synthetic perspiration be 36 DEG C~37 DEG C, with imitate synthetic perspiration from human body out when temperature so that mosquito can not Determine whether that human body sends breath from temperature, and then improve the attractant effect to mosquito.The real-time monitoring of liquid level sensor 316 The liquid level of synthetic perspiration in tray 311, controls heater 314 and works, it is to avoid security incident occurs, and controls when liquid level is too low Warning light processed is opened, to point out user to add synthetic perspiration, it is ensured that the normal operation of mosquito catcher work.
